Dealing with Drop Down Menus
Don't you get tired of scrolling through long drop down box lists? I know
that I do. I'm gonna show you an easy way to get through them today. I'll illustrate
how to do it with an example.
Let's say you're filling out an online registration form that asks for your
country. If you live in Australia, you're all set since your country is towards
the top. But what if you live here in the US? We have to scroll through tons
of countries (many of which we've never heard of) to get to the entry for "United
States."
Well, here's a quicker way. When you get to the box, click the first letter
of the item you're hunting for. You'll find that items beginning with that
letter start popping up in the drop box. So, when you get to the box, just
hit the letter "U" until "United States" comes up.
Yeah! No more scrolling!
